Are steel or graphite shafts better for seniors?

Generally speaking, graphite shafts are better for seniors than steel shafts unless the senior still maintains very high swing speeds. There are some seniors in incredible shape that can easily hit a regular steel shaft in their iron.

What swing speed needs a senior flex shaft?

Between 72 and 83 mph signifies you need to be hitting senior flex. Ladies – By no means do all women's golfers will fall in this category, but this is where many of the recreational women's players find themselves. This range is going to be for anyone with a swing speed slower than 72 mph.

What is the difference between a senior flex shaft and a ladies flex shaft?

There is not much difference at all between ladies and senior flex. Most of the time, the only difference between a senior flex shaft and a ladies flex shaft will be the length of the shaft. The senior flex shaft can sometimes be a few grams heavier than the ladies, but this all depends on the manufacturer.

How fast should a golf shaft be?

Some golfers will decide which shaft they need based on swing speed alone. If your swing speed is between 75 and 85 miles per hour, then you will need a senior shaft. If you are between 85 and 95 miles per hour, then the regular shaft will be the best choice. You can get your swing speed measured at a local golf fitting center.

How long is a golf shaft?

Firstly, let’s talk about the rules of golf. The maximum shaft you are allowed to use 48 inches in length. However, very few people would want a shaft that long since the average shaft falls between 44” to 46”. The longer your shaft, the harder it will be to control the ball.
